Kadai Paneer..........Simple and Tasty

INGREDIENTS:
Paneer made out of 1 litre milk or bought (300gms).
Diced onions (2 big).
Diced tomatoes (2 big).
Diced capsicum  (1 big).
Ginger paste (1 Tsp), Cumin seeds (1 TBs).
Charmagaz seeds(1 TBs) + Tomato(1) + Onion(1) altogether ground to paste.
Red chilli powder (1 Tsp), Turmeric powder (1 Tsp), Garam masala powder (1 Tsp), Coriander powder (1 Tsp), Kashmiri chilli powder (1 Tsp).
Salt to taste.
Oil for cooking.
Ghee or Butter (1 TBs).

PROCEDURE:
Heat oil in a pan add cumin seeds and now fry onions, tomatoes and capsicum to golden brown and keep aside, now in the same pan add little oil and add paste and ginger paste along with salt and cook till oil leaves the walls of pan, now add chilli powder, turmeric, kashmiri mirchi powder, coriander powder, garam masala powder and stir well so that all mixes up well, if required add little water so that ingredients dont burn up, once the oil leaves the walls of pan, add fried veggies which were kept aside, and saute well, now add little water say about 1/2 cup and add diced paneer to it, let it cook for a minute or two. Now check the consistency of gravy and off the flame. Add ghee or butter. Serve it with roti, naan or paratha.
